Choosing an engagement ring is one of the most meaningful jewelry decisions you will make. This engagement ring buying guide helps you balance setting style, stone shape, metal tone, and lifestyle so the final design feels unmistakably personal.
Start with the wearer's style
Look at the jewelry already worn daily. Minimalists often prefer solitaire or bezel settings, while romantic profiles lean toward oval, pear, or vintage-inspired silhouettes. Save inspiration images, then compare proportions on the hand rather than on screen alone.

Metal and durability considerations
Yellow gold brings warmth, white gold offers a crisp modern tone, and platinum delivers exceptional durability. Consider skin tone, existing jewelry metals, and how often the ring will be worn during travel or active days.
Ring size and timeline planning
Confirm ring size discreetly using an existing band or professional sizing before production begins. Allow time for resizing windows, engraving, and delivery if you are planning a proposal date.
